What this scenario looks like

A cold weather slip and fall hazard is any loss of footing caused by ice, snow, sleet, frost, or refrozen meltwater on a walking or working surface — compounded by cold that stiffens muscles, reduces dexterity, and slows the reflexes that would otherwise catch a stumble.

In practice it shows up as black ice on ramps and stairs, packed snow on scaffold planks and decking, refrozen melt around entrances and gutters, frost on metal ladders and rungs, and untreated parking and lay-down areas. The hazard often appears overnight or after a thaw-freeze cycle, so a surface that was safe yesterday is treacherous this morning.

The danger is that ice is frequently invisible — black ice looks like wet pavement, and a thin frost on a rung offers no warning until a boot skates off it. At height the consequences are catastrophic, but even ground-level falls on ice cause fractures and head injuries. Because conditions change with temperature, the surface must be reassessed as the weather shifts.

Why this scenario matters

Immediate consequences

A slip on ice at height near an unprotected edge can be fatal, and even ground-level falls cause wrist, hip, and head injuries. Cold-stiffened muscles make workers less able to recover from a slip before they go down.

Legal & financial impact

OSHA's walking-working surface and fall protection standards require surfaces to be kept clear of hazards, including ice and snow. Serious violations exceed $16,000, and ignoring known icing conditions supports willful classification above $165,000.

Operational impact

Winter slips drive lost-time injuries, workers' comp claims, and stoppages during the season when daylight is short and schedules are already compressed by weather delays.

Industry-specific concerns

Construction, roofing, utilities, and outdoor logistics face the most winter exposure, with elevated risk on scaffolds, ladders, roofs, and loading docks where ice and height combine.

Real incident case study

A frosted scaffold plank on a cold clear morning

The situation

A masonry crew returned to a three-story scaffold on a clear morning after an overnight freeze. The planks looked dry, so the crew climbed up and began work without treating or inspecting the platform for frost.

What went wrong

A thin, near-invisible frost had formed on the metal-framed planks overnight. A worker shifting position lost traction, slipped toward the platform edge, and fell to the guardrail — striking it hard enough to fracture two ribs. Had the guardrail gap been wider, the fall could have been fatal.

How OSHA Scan would have prevented it

A photo scan of the scaffold before climbing would have flagged the frosted planks and the icing risk on the elevated platform, cited 29 CFR 1926.501, and prompted the crew to clear and treat the planks, verify guardrails, and delay work until the surface was safe.

Lessons learned

'Looks dry' is not the same as safe in freezing conditions. Overnight frost and black ice are invisible, so winter surfaces must be inspected and treated before work — especially at height.

Prevention best practices

Layered controls, from most to least effective.

Engineering controls

Eliminate ice and restore traction on work and travel surfaces.

  • Clear snow and ice from walkways, stairs, ramps, and work platforms before use
  • Apply de-icer, sand, or grit to travel routes and access points
  • Install slip-resistant matting, treads, and traction strips on stairs and ramps
  • Provide heated or covered access points and lay-down areas where feasible

Administrative controls

Plan for winter conditions and reassess as temperatures change.

  • Monitor forecasts and thaw-freeze cycles that create overnight black ice
  • Inspect and treat surfaces before each shift and after weather changes
  • Reschedule or restrict elevated work when platforms cannot be kept clear
  • Establish and mark designated cleared travel routes across the site
  • Document the winter-conditions assessment with a time-stamped photo scan

Personal protective equipment

Equip workers for traction and cold without sacrificing dexterity.

  • Provide insulated, slip-resistant footwear and ice cleats for outdoor work
  • Supply cold-weather gloves that retain grip and dexterity
  • Require fall arrest for elevated winter work with anchors verified in cold
  • Layer with warm, high-visibility clothing that does not restrict movement

OSHA compliance & citations

The federal standards this hazard may relate to.

29 CFR 1926.501

Duty to have fall protection

Requires fall protection at 6 feet or more, with heightened importance when ice and snow reduce traction on elevated surfaces near unprotected edges.

Up to $16,550 per serious violation; $165,514 for willful or repeat

29 CFR 1926.25

Housekeeping

Requires walking and working areas to be kept clear of hazards, including the accumulation of snow and ice that creates slip hazards.

Up to $16,550 per serious violation

29 CFR 1910.22

Walking-working surfaces — general requirements

Requires walking-working surfaces to be kept clean, orderly, and free of hazards such as ice and snow that create slip and fall risks.

Up to $16,550 per serious violation

Incident response protocol

If an incident occurs, act fast and in order.

Immediate actions (first 5 minutes)

  1. 1Call 911 for any serious injury, especially a fall from height
  2. 2Do not move a worker with a suspected head, neck, or back injury unless in danger
  3. 3Establish a safe perimeter and stop work on the icy surface
  4. 4Provide first aid and protect the injured worker from cold exposure
  5. 5Assign someone to direct emergency responders to the location

Emergency response (5-30 minutes)

  1. 1Cooperate fully with arriving emergency responders
  2. 2Treat or barricade the icy surface to prevent a second fall
  3. 3Account for all workers and pause work on affected surfaces
  4. 4Document the scene and surface conditions with photos
  5. 5Notify the site safety lead and management

Post-incident

  1. 1Notify OSHA within 8 hours for a fatality or 24 hours for an in-patient hospitalization
  2. 2Investigate surface treatment, inspection timing, and conditions
  3. 3Preserve footwear, equipment, and the winter-assessment record
  4. 4Interview the crew about conditions and treatment status
  5. 5Revise winter surface-control procedures and retrain the crew

Frequently asked questions

Does OSHA require employers to remove ice and snow?

Yes. OSHA's housekeeping and walking-working surface standards require walkways and work areas to be kept free of hazards, including ice and snow. Employers must clear, treat, or otherwise control icy surfaces before workers use them.

Why is cold weather itself a fall risk?

Cold stiffens muscles, reduces dexterity, and slows reaction time, so workers are less able to catch themselves in a slip. Combined with icy surfaces, this makes both the likelihood and the severity of falls higher in winter.

What makes black ice so dangerous?

Black ice is a thin, transparent layer that looks like wet or bare pavement, so workers do not see it and do not adjust their footing. It forms during thaw-freeze cycles and overnight freezes, often appearing on surfaces that were safe hours earlier.

Is it safe to work at height in winter conditions?

Only after platforms are cleared, treated, and inspected. Ice on scaffolds, decking, and ladders combined with height is extremely dangerous. If a surface cannot be kept reliably clear, elevated work should be rescheduled.

What footwear helps prevent winter slips?

Insulated, slip-resistant footwear rated for cold and ice, and ice cleats for the worst conditions. Traction is the priority for outdoor winter work, alongside gloves that keep hands warm without sacrificing grip and dexterity.

How often should surfaces be re-inspected in winter?

Inspect and treat before each shift and again whenever temperatures cross freezing or precipitation occurs. Thaw-freeze cycles can create new black ice within hours, so a single morning check is not enough on changeable days.

What are the penalties for uncontrolled ice hazards?

A serious violation of housekeeping, walking-working surface, or fall protection standards exceeds $16,000, and knowingly leaving icing conditions uncontrolled can support willful classification with penalties above $165,000.
